Muscle supplied by 9th cranial nerve:
**Core Concept**
The 9th cranial nerve, also known as the glossopharyngeal nerve, is a mixed nerve that provides sensory, motor, and parasympathetic innervation to various structures in the head and neck. Specifically, it is responsible for controlling the muscles of the pharynx and providing sensory input from the posterior one-third of the tongue.
**Why the Correct Answer is Right**
The glossopharyngeal nerve (9th cranial nerve) supplies the stylopharyngeus muscle, which is a skeletal muscle involved in the process of swallowing (deglutition). The stylopharyngeus muscle originates from the styloid process of the temporal bone and inserts into the pharyngeal constrictor muscle. It helps to elevate the pharynx during swallowing, thereby facilitating the passage of food into the esophagus.
